Big con for you is that there is a good chance you will not be able to attend school in Florida or even work there immediately after graduation. My understanding has been that you should be prepared to go where you need to go to become a CRNA. This means applying to multiple schools around the country. I am not saying it is impossible but it is unlikely to stay all in one area and accomplish school and your first job.

No one can tell you how the job market will look in the future. Florida is a very desirable market.
